EPPN: Urge US representatives to support anti-hunger legislationPosted Dec 9, 2014 |
[Episcopal Public Policy Network] This week, the House of Representatives is expected to vote on the Global Food Security Act of 2014 (H.R. 5656). The legislation will help millions of people who suffer from chronic food insecurity in developing countries.
The Episcopal Church is committed to fighting the injustice of extreme hunger and poverty. As our Baptismal Covenant reminds us, all human life must be valued, for we are children of God. Take a moment today to live out this call.
